Suspect nabbed for possession of unlicensed firearm and ammunition

MT FLETCHER – In concerted efforts to eradicate the proliferation of unlicensed firearms and ammunition, a male suspect, age 33, was arrested at Solomzi location in Mt Fletcher.

It is alleged that on 15 March 2021, a team of detectives operationalized after receiving a community tip-off about a wanted suspect in a case of robbery.

The members followed up on the information and approached the suspect at the identified place at Solomzi location.

Upon searching the suspect, members found a firearm and 5 rounds of live ammunition in his possession.

The suspect was arrested and detained at Mt Flecther Police station. He will appear in in court soon facing two counts of possession of unlicensed firearm and ammunition.

The acting District Commissioner, Brigadier Rudolph Adolph lauded the Detectives for their sterling efforts in the recovery of a firearm.
